Assignment of Dirty Martini leases

 

Further to the Company's announcement on 9 June 2023, Nightcap (AIM: NGHT),
the owner of The Cocktail Club, the Adventure Bar Group, Barrio Familia and
the Dirty Martini group of bars, announces that it has completed the process
of assigning the Dirty Martini leases from the administrator, Leonard Curtis
Recovery Limited (the "Administrator").

When Nightcap acquired certain assets of DC Bars Limited and Tuttons Brasserie
Limited, the operator of the 'Dirty Martini' chain of cocktail bars and
Tuttons Brasserie, a critical part of the process was securing the assignment
of leases for the key sites from the Administrator, with the consent from the
relevant landlords.

The Company is pleased to announce that this process has now been successfully
completed and Nightcap will continue trading in nine of the ten sites
previously operated by DC Bars Limited.

Eight out of ten leases have been assigned on existing terms (only subject to
rent reviews) and these assigned leases have expiry dates between 2030 and
2047.

One site previously operated by DC Bars Limited has not been assigned.  This
is the Hanover Square site, where the Company could not agree with the
landlord on reduced rental costs to make the site profitable, and therefore no
agreement could be reached to keep trading at the site.

The Company has entered into a new three year lease for the Tuttons restaurant
and Dirty Martini Covent Garden site. This lease covers a restaurant lease as
well as the small downstairs cocktail bar. The new lease is on considerably
more favourable commercial terms and is in line with Nightcap's objective to
not remain as a restaurant operator in the long term.

The completion of the assignments secures 95% of the historic £23.7 million
of aggregated annual revenue and all of the historic £3.9 million annual site
EBITDA, based on DC Bars Limited's and Tuttons Brasserie Limited unaudited
management accounts for the year ended 31 December 2022.

The Company will make a further announcement in due course in relation to
deferred consideration for the acquisition.

 

Sarah Willingham, Chief Executive Officer of Nightcap, commented:

"The successful assignment of all of the important and profitable Dirty
Martini leases completes the acquisition of Dirty Martini and preserves the
majority of historic revenue and EBITDA which is the outcome we have worked
hard to achieve since the acquisition in June 2023.

"We are exceptionally pleased with how well the staff across the Dirty Martini
estate have embraced becoming part of Nightcap and we are excited by what the
brand has brought to Nightcap, both in terms of great locations as well as the
overall high quality of the estate."
